Sinossi

"L2TP Protocol Implementation and Configuration""L2TP Protocol Implementation and Configuration" is the definitive, in-depth guide for networking professionals, engineers, and architects seeking mastery over the Layer 2 Tunneling Protocol (L2TP). Beginning with a rigorous exploration of L2TP’s evolution, core architecture, and operational principles, the book demystifies protocol mechanics, from control and data plane separation to session multiplexing and real-world deployment scenarios. The nuanced discussion addresses the modern relevance of L2TP—spanning ISPs, enterprises, and mobile networks—establishing a comprehensive foundation for understanding both classical and contemporary applications.Delving into the detailed protocol specification, the work meticulously covers initialization, AVP negotiation, reliability mechanisms, error recovery, and interoperability challenges. Readers are guided through software design patterns for robust L2TP engines, including memory management, concurrency, multi-threaded processing, and diagnostics. Security receives thorough attention, with a dedicated section to L2TP over IPsec, threat mitigation, authentication schemes, and best practices for modern enterprise and carrier-grade environments. Readers also benefit from practical configuration guidance for servers, clients, authentication integration, and scalable deployment within IPv6 and dual-stack infrastructures.The book’s advanced chapters provide invaluable insights into large-scale provider deployments, hybrid VPN architectures, NAT traversal, and service chaining within SDN and NFV contexts. Extensive coverage of testing, debugging, and performance engineering methodologies ensures readers are well-equipped to validate and optimize implementations. Looking to the future, the text analyzes emerging standards, protocol extensibility, cloud-native architectures, and the impact of SASE on VPN technologies. Illustrated with real-world case studies, this book is an indispensable technical resource for anyone involved in designing, securing, implementing, or operating L2TP-based network solutions.

    Medical research is the backbone of advancing healthcare, providing critical insights that shape clinical practices, influence public health policies, and guide the development of new treatments. The primary goal of medical research is to generate reliable and reproducible evidence that can inform decisions on diagnosing, treating, and preventing diseases. By understanding the methods of medical research, healthcare professionals and researchers can better evaluate, design, and implement studies that contribute to improving patient care. 
    The importance of research in medicine cannot be overstated, as it allows for the discovery of new knowledge, the development of innovative therapies, and the evaluation of existing medical practices. Medical research has been instrumental in reducing mortality rates, improving the quality of life, and enhancing the effectiveness of treatments. Moreover, it plays a crucial role in addressing emerging health challenges, such as pandemics, chronic diseases, and antimicrobial resistance. 
    At the heart of medical research are study designs, which dictate the methodology for investigating hypotheses and answering research questions. Different types of research designs are used depending on the objectives of the study, the nature of the research question, and the available resources. These designs are broadly categorized into two types: experimental and observational. Experimental designs, such as randomized controlled trials (RCTs), involve the manipulation of variables to test the effects of an intervention, whereas observational designs, such as cohort or case-control studies, examine associations without direct manipulation. Each design has its strengths and limitations, and the choice of design depends on the specific research question, ethical considerations, and feasibility.

    In a world increasingly run by algorithms and artificial intelligence, Hatim Rahman traces how organizations are using algorithms to control workers in an "invisible cage." 
     
     
      
    Inside the Invisible Cage uses unique longitudinal data to investigate how digital labor platforms use algorithms to dictate the actions of high-skilled workers by determining accepted behaviors, work opportunities, and even success. As Hatim Rahman explains, employers can use algorithms to shift rules and guidelines without notice, explanation, or recourse for workers. The invisible cage signals a profound shift in the way markets and organizations categorize and ultimately control people. 
     
     
      
    Unlike previous forms of labor control, the invisible cage is ubiquitous, yet it is also opaque and shifting, which makes breaking free from it difficult for workers. This book traces how the invisible cage was developed over time and the implications it has for the spread of new technology, such as generative artificial intelligence. Inside the Invisible Cage also provides organizations, workers, and policymakers with insights on how to ensure the future of work has truly equitable, mutually beneficial outcomes.

    Kinesiology, the scientific study of human movement, is a multidisciplinary field that integrates principles from anatomy, physiology, biomechanics, and neuroscience. It examines how the body moves, the forces that act upon it, and the underlying mechanisms that control movement. By understanding these principles, professionals in various fields, including physical therapy, sports science, and occupational therapy, can enhance human performance, prevent injuries, and improve rehabilitation strategies. 
    The origins of kinesiology date back to ancient civilizations, where scholars like Aristotle and Galen first explored the mechanics of movement. However, the field gained prominence in the 19th and 20th centuries as scientific advancements allowed for a deeper understanding of biomechanics and motor control. Today, kinesiology encompasses a vast range of topics, from the microscopic study of muscle fibers to large-scale analyses of athletic performance. 
    One of the core components of kinesiology is biomechanics, which applies the principles of physics and engineering to study how forces influence movement. Biomechanics helps explain how the body maintains balance, generates power, and absorbs impact. For example, analyzing the gait cycle of a runner can reveal inefficiencies that may lead to injuries. By optimizing movement patterns, biomechanics contributes to improving athletic performance and developing assistive technologies such as prosthetics and orthotics.
